Opel Zafira Pop & Bang Tuning
On Opel Zafira (1999–2016) turbo petrol engines, Pop & Bang software produces controlled pops and crackles from the exhaust when you lift off. The intensity is adjustable; with engine and catalyst safety in mind, the original software is backed up and the result is checked on a road test.

Frequently asked questions
Is Pop & Bang tuning available for the Opel Zafira?
Yes, where the ECU on the Opel Zafira turbo petrol engine supports it. The ECU is identified first; Pop & Bang is usually applied together with Stage 1 and the intensity is set to your preference. The original software is kept.
Will it damage the exhaust?
An aggressive setting can. Thermal load on the catalyst, turbo and exhaust valves rises, so we keep the setting measured and limit it to the car's hardware.
Can it be done with a catalyst fitted?
It can, but we do not recommend it; raw fuel reaching the catalyst shortens its life. We explain this clearly before you decide.
Is it suitable for road use?
Noise and environmental rules apply. This work is intended for track and show use; responsibility for road use rests with the owner.
